This end of the year definitely looks like a descent into hell for Sam Lowes who seemed to have done the hard part by winning his ticket to MotoGP. An official pilot contract for the Aprilia factory. Then there was the disappointing epilogue to his Moto2 campaign, the little envied mark of the rider who crashed the most in Grand Prix and finally the tests with the RS-GP. From which came the rumor of his replacement by Eugène Laverty.

This is called falling from Charybdis to Scylla. And to fall, Sam Lowes knows the subject. He crashed in Valencia during pre-season testing on the first day. A violent shock which forced him to rest for the second. Alex's twin brother, a Yamaha Superbike rider, still managed to Jerez to continue his mission to discover Noale's machine. Without convincing. Worse, doubts have arisen about its future.

Noises that his chief engineer Giulio Nava wanted to silence by putting his pilot’s performance in a context marked by a small form: “ Sam still suffers from the after-effects of his fall in Valencia » he specifies on GP One. " But he wanted to be in Jerez to continue working on the RS-GP. A long season awaits us and it is important to accumulate kilometers with the bike and to familiarize ourselves with the team ».

« Despite his difficult physical condition, these tests were useful to Sam for his learning. I am sure he will start to show his potential when the school year begins in Malaysia. The tests he has completed so far cannot be taken into consideration to judge his level. ».

Sam Lowes clocked 1'42.312 against 1'39.675 signed by his teammate Aleix Espargaró, in full possession of his means and with overflowing enthusiasm for his RS-GP Aprilia.
